Jake and the Never Land Pirates

I was a little excited to have my daughter dress up as Izzy and my son to dress up as Cubby. However, if your child is interested in dressing up as a character from Jake and the Never Land Pirates, it’s not too hard to replicate. Jake wears blue pants, a white t-shirt, red headband and brown boots. Cubby has red shorts, a white shirt, blue bandana and brown shoes. The trickiest part is the blue vest that both characters wear. You can take a dark blue t-shirt and cut off the sleeves. Then, cut it up the middle and sew on some gold trim (Cubby has gold buttons instead). Izzy wears purplish-blue pants, red boots and a satin pink tunic. She also has a pink bandana with a gold doubloon pouch necklace. My Little Pony

There are quite a few my little pony costumes. A velour jumpsuit and wig in your ponies’ color makes a great base for a Halloween costume. You can make a tail out of several pieces of felt cut into wavy pieces. Another idea is to take a ponytail extension clip-on for the tail. Justice League/ Superhero Costumes

In my experience, kids love to play superheroes. Many costumes like Superman and Batman can be pulled off with tighter pants, a long sleeved shirt and a cape. Supergirl requires a long sleeved blue shirt with a red, circle skirt and cape.
